Huawei Device Spotlights Portfolio at CTIA
Company experiencing rapid growth in U.S.
SAN DIEGO, Oct. 11, 2011 /PRNewswire/ -- Huawei Device, one of the world's largest handset manufacturers, today spotlights its growing portfolio in the U.S. at CTIA Enterprise & Applications Conference and Expo 2011 in San Diego, Calif.
The company is experiencing rapid growth in U.S. having just strategically launched multiple devices into carriers including: the T-Mobile® SpringBoard™ with Google™, Huawei's first affordable Android-based tablet into T-Mobile and the U.S.; the T-Mobile® Sonic™ 4G Mobile Hotspot, T-Mobile's fastest 4G (HSPA+ 42) mobile hotspot; the Impulse 4G, Huawei's first affordable Android-based smartphone into AT&T Wireless; and the Huawei Ascend II, the successor to Cricket Wireless® highly-successful deployment of its first low-cost Android device.

Visitors to Huawei's booth #1017 will be able to view devices including the T-Mobile® SpringBoard™ with Google™, the T-Mobile® Sonic™ 4G Mobile Hotspot, Impulse 4G on AT&T Wireless, Huawei Ascend II on Cricket Wireless, and the Huawei M835 and Huawei Pinnacle on MetroPCS.

About Huawei Device
Huawei Device Co., Ltd's products cover a wide range of market sectors including mobile phones, mobile broadband devices, and home devices. Our products also include the Hi Space App Store and the Management Cloud, which are solutions that make devices smarter and easier to use. With our primary focus on the consumers, Huawei Device is committed to creating the most influential smart device brands in the world, providing user-friendly mobile Internet experiences. As of the end of 2010, Huawei Device's products were available through more than 500 operators all over the world. Huawei Device has established strategic partnerships with many of the world's leading operators including Telefonica, China Mobile, Vodafone, T-Mobile, BT, China Telecom, NTT Docomo, France Telecom, and China Unicom.
